Literature summary for 3.5.1.5 extracted from

  • Arioli, S.; Monnet, C.; Guglielmetti, S.; Parini, C.; De Noni, I.; Hogenboom, J.; Halami, P.M.; Mora, D.
    Aspartate biosynthesis is essential for the growth of Streptococcus thermophilus in milk, and aspartate availability modulates the level of urease activity (2007), Appl. Environ. Microbiol., 73, 5789-5796.
